우수한 소프트웨어와 실용적인 튜토리얼
리눅스 포맷 USB 디스크
Windows에서 USB 플래시 드라이브를 포맷하는 것은 매우 간단합니다. 마우스 오른쪽 버튼을 클릭하여 포맷하거나 하드 디스크 파티션을 입력하여 포맷할 수 있습니다. Linux에서는 어떨까요? 사실 Linux에서도 USB 플래시 드라이브를 포맷하는 것은 매우 간단합니다. 몇 가지 명령만 입력하면 됩니다. 자세히 살펴보겠습니다.Linux에서 USB 드라이브를 포맷하는 방법.
1. 형식
/dev/sda1 파티션을 포맷하고 USB 디스크 시스템을 FAT로 포맷합니다.
# 먼저 파티션을 마운트 해제해야 합니다. umount /dev/sda1 # -F 매개변수는 대문자여야 합니다. 매개변수는 12, 16, 32이며, 각각 FAT12, FAT16, FAT32에 해당합니다. mkfs.vfat -F 32 /dev/sda1
NTFS 파티션으로 포맷하고 먼저 설치하세요 ntfsprogs
dnf install ntfsprogs # 포맷하기 전에 파티션을 언마운트해야 합니다 umount /dev/sda1 # ntfs로 포맷하는 과정이 약간 느립니다. 잠시만 기다려 주세요 mkfs.ntfs /dev/sda1
ext4/3/2로 포맷:
# 먼저 파티션 마운트 해제 umount /dev/sda1 # ext4 파티션으로 포맷 mkfs.ext4 /dev/sda1 # ext3 파티션으로 포맷 mkfs.ext3 /dev/sda1 # ext2 파티션으로 포맷 mkfs.ext2 /dev/sda1
ext 시리즈 파티션에는 슈퍼 유저를 위한 예약된 공간이 있으므로, 기본적으로 5%라는 일정 비율을 차지해야 합니다. 따라서 작은 파티션을 포맷할 때 5%가 차지하는 부담을 느끼지 못할 것입니다. 하지만 5%는 크지 않습니다. 하지만 수백 GB에 달하는 파티션이라면 1T 파티션에서도 문제가 발생할 수 있습니다. 이 경우 5%는 결코 작은 숫자가 아닙니다!
예약된 공간을 차지하는 ext 파티션에 대한 솔루션
파티션을 포맷하려면 ext3를 예로 들어 보겠습니다.
#먼저 umount /dev/sda1 파티션을 마운트 해제합니다. #-m 뒤에 매개변수가 있는데, 이 설정은 이미 백분위수이며 0.05로 설정되어 있습니다. %, 즉 10,000분의 5입니다! mkfs.ext3 -m 0.05 /dev/sda1
1TB 파티션을 예로 들어 보겠습니다. 1TB = 1024GB = 1048576MB이고, 여기에 1024를 곱하면 1048576MB*0.0005=524.288MB가 됩니다. 즉, -m 매개변수를 설정하면 예약된 영역은 약 524MB가 됩니다. 물론, 사용자의 취향에 따라 설정할 수 있습니다.
이미 포맷된 파티션의 경우 해당 파티션의 데이터를 지우고 싶지 않으면 다음을 사용할 수 있습니다. 튠2fs -m 방법:
#이 명령은 파티션을 먼저 마운트 해제할 필요가 없습니다. tune2fs -m 0.05 /dev/sda2 #이 예제는 /dev/sda2 파티션의 슈퍼 유저 예약 영역을 변환하고 0.05로 설정합니다. 다시 한번 말씀드리지만, 0.05입니다. %는 1만분의 5입니다.
mkfs -t ext4 /dev/sdb1은 지정된 파티션을 포맷합니다.
-t는 파일 시스템 유형을 지정합니다.
ext4 파일 유형
2. 분할
Linux U 디스크 파티션 포맷 fdisk 명령
fdisk /dev/sdb fdisk 명령어 작업 공간을 입력하세요
A. 명령(m은 도움말): m /명령 보기/ 주요 명령은 다음과 같습니다. d 파티션 삭제 파티션 삭제 m 이 메뉴 인쇄 메뉴 인쇄 n 새 파티션 추가 새 파티션 추가 p 파티션 테이블 인쇄 파티션 목록 인쇄 q 변경 사항을 저장하지 않고 종료 저장하지 않고 종료 w 디스크에 테이블 쓰기 및 종료 디스크 목록 쓰기 및 종료 B. 명령(m은 도움말): p /파티션 목록 인쇄/ C. 명령(m은 도움말): d /파티션 삭제/ 파티션 번호(1-4):1 D. 명령(m은 도움말): p /지금은 파티션이 없는지 확인/ E. 명령(m은 도움말): w /마지막으로 파티션 테이블 쓰기
다음으로 디스크에 파티션을 추가하고 포맷합니다.
ls /dev/sd* /fdisk 명령 작업 입력 space/
#/dev/sda /dev/sda1 /dev/sda2 /dev/sdb
fdisk /dev/sdb /fdisk 명령 입력 작업 space/
A. 명령(도움말은 m으로 입력): n /새로운 파티션 만들기/ 명령 동작 e 확장 p 기본 파티션(1-4) p /기본 파티션 추가/ B. 파티션 번호(1-4):1 C. 첫 번째 실린더(1-1011, 기본값): /기본값으로 입력/ 기본값 1 사용 마지막 실린더, +실린더 또는 +크기{K,M,G}(1-1011, 기본값,1011): /기본값으로 입력/ 기본값 1011 사용 D. 명령(도움말은 m으로 입력):p /현재 sdb1 파티션이 있습니다/ E. 명령(도움말은 m으로 입력): w /마지막으로 파티션 테이블 쓰기/ F. sudo mkfs.vfat -F 32 -n disk /dev/sdb1 /format
3. USB 드라이브 문자 변경
#e2label /dev/sdb1 "Tony"(볼륨 레이블 이름이 설정됨, 디스크는 ext4 형식임)
4. 하드디스크 파티션 확인
1. lsblk -f 모든 장치의 마운트 상태를 확인합니다.
2. 블키드